Sri Lotus Developers and Realty IPO Closes at 31% premium, Market Cap Closes above $1.1 Bn

Mumbai, August 7, 2025: Shares of Sri Lotus Developers and Realty Limited made an impressive debut on the exchange to close at 31.23 per cent premium. The market cap closed above $1.1 billion. The scrip listed at INR 179.10 per share on the BSE, a premium of 19.40 per cent, and INR 178 per share on the NSE, a premium of 18.67 per cent.
The company’s share price closed at INR 196.85 per share on the BSE, a 31.23 per cent premium, and at INR 195.80 on the NSE, a 30.53 per cent premium. Per NSE, the total quantity traded stood at 918.23 lakh shares. On BSE, the total quantity stood at 169.41 lakh shares. Total Turnover (BSE+NSE) on Day 1 stood at INR 2,035.08 crore.

The market capitalisation at today’s closing price stood at INR 9,620.53 crore, per BSE, and INR 9,569.21 crore, per NSE.
The company had offered INR 792 crore issue for subscription from July 30 to August 1. This garnered substantial interest, and the offer was subscribed to around 74 times. The qualified institutional buyer portion and the non-institutional investor portion were subscribed 175 times and 61.82 times, respectively, whereas the retail portion was subscribed 21.77 times. The employee portion was subscribed 21.37 times.
Sri Lotus Developers and Realty is a developer of residential and commercial premises in Mumbai with a focus on redevelopment projects in the ultra-luxury and luxury segments in the western suburbs under the “Lotus Developers” brand.
As of June 30, the company completed a developable area of 0.93 million square feet consisting of residential and commercial properties.
The developments focus primarily on ultra-luxury and luxury residential properties and commercial properties through construction and development of 2BHK and 3 BHK flats with a price range of INR 3 crore to INR 7 crores (luxury residential segment); construction and development of 3BHK, 4 BHK and 4+ BHK flats and penthouses with a price of above INR 7 crores (ultra-luxury residential segment together with the luxury residential segment); and construction and development of commercial offices (commercial segment).
